When can I expect good weather in Le Grand-Saconnex?
Planning for the weather is a good way to make your trip to Le Grand-Saconnex relaxing and enjoyable, especially when you're splurging.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 64°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 36°F. Average annual precipitation for Le Grand-Saconnex is 65 inches.
What's there to see and do in Le Grand-Saconnex?
Experience Le Grand-Saconnex with a stop at Geneva Arena, World Trade Organization Headquarters, and International Museum of the Red Cross and Red Crescent. If you have a little extra time during your trip, you might want to make a stop at Ariana Ceramics and Glass Museum and United Nations European Headquarters.
